Arvada celebrates third annual town festival

The third annual Arvada Days festival will be held this year at Clear Creak Valley Park from 11:00 am to 3:00 pm. This event will feature music, contests, food, and local vendors.

Before the event officially starts, there will be a historical bike ride, which will cover ten miles and visit ten different historic sites around Arvada. Riders will meet at 8:45 and begin the ride at 9 am. It will only be 1.5 miles to the festival from the end of the bike route.

The kids’ fishing contest will feature three age groups: five to eight, nine to twelve, and thirteen to fifteen. Each age group will have 45 minutes to catch and release fish, and awards will be given to the top three in each age group. Preregistration is required, and check-in will begin at 9:30 am on the day of the event.

There will also be a Dutch oven cook-off open to all ages. Contestants must bring their own supplies, including grill and fuel, and must do all cooking at the park. There are no restrictions on the type of food, and prizes will be given to the top competitors in both the adult and youth groups.
